As much as I loved the crazy shopping last year they would have been in better shape if they'd gone with rookies. So we'd be stuck down where Montreal, Ottawa and Buffalo are. Listen, their young core all gained NHL Experience last year while ours were still in the AHL. The smart move is you take the lumps and bumps with the kids but you add NHL experience to your young core. Then add the veterans.
In my opinion, the state of the '24-'25 Red Wings is meh. I think they'll end up with somewhere around the 15th to 18th best record and either wiggle into the playoffs or else fall a wee bit short again. The defenseman group is pretty suspect, especially at RD, and the goalie glut needs to be sorted out. Three middle-of-the-pack guys isn't the answer to that question.
